WebHitler’s rise to power traces to 1919, when he joined the German Workers’ Party that became the Nazi Party. With his oratorical skills and use of propaganda, he soon became its leader. Hitler gained popularity nationwide by exploiting unrest during the Great Depression, and in 1932 he placed second in the presidential race. WebJan 30, 2024 · In March 1938, Hitler marched on — and annexed — Austria. The fall of the Sudetenland was foretold following the Allies’ infamous September 1938 agreement at Munich to yield to Hitler’s insatiable demands.
